1. GEORGIAN PREMIER DISCUSSED ISSUES OF EUROPEAN INTEGRATION WITH FOREIGN MINISTERS OF POLAND AND SWEDEN
Politics

Today, Georgia’s Prime Minister Giorgi Kvirikashvili held a meeting in Tbilisi with Foreign Ministers of Poland and Sweden – Witold Waszczykowski and Margot Wallstrom.

As administration of Georgian government said, “the progress, made by Georgia on the way of European integration, was emphasized” at the meeting.

2. ASSOCIATION OF YOUNG FINANCIERS AND BUSINESSMEN: SHORT-TERM DEVALUATION OF LARI CANNOT BE ATTRIBUTED TO FUNDAMENTAL FACTORS
Economics

Vice-president of Young Financiers and Businessmen Association Paata Bairakhtari declared that “all those macroeconomic parameters, which influence stability of lari, maintain stable growth”. “Respectively, we cannot attribute short-term depreciation of national currency to fundamental factors”, he pointed.

3. “SOCIETY AND BANKS”: DAMAGE, INFLICTED BY FINANCIAL PYRAMIDS DURING THE LAST YEAR, REACHED 100M LARI
Economics

Non-governmental organization Society and Banks declared that damage, inflicted by financial pyramids during the last year, has reached 100 million lari. Number of affected people makes up 4,000, the organization specified.

4. ACTING FINANCE MINISTER: ALL REFORMS, ENVISAGED BY 4-POINT PLAN OF THE GOVERNMENT, WILL PROCEED IN THE MINISTRY
Politics

Today, Mamuka Bakhtadze held the first working meeting in the rank of acting Finance Minister in the Ministry.

As Bakhtadze declared, all reforms, envisaged by 4-point plan of the government, will proceed in the Ministry.

5. NON-GOVERNMENTAL BRANCH ORGANIZATIONS WELCOME STRUCTURAL CHANGES IN THE GOVERNMENT
Society

“We positively estimate project of structural changes, announced by the government, as a result of which merger of several ministries is planned”, statement released by non-governmental branch organizations says.

“Start and correct implementation of the mentioned changes will promote saving of bureaucratic expenses and growth of efficiency of the government”, the organizations consider.

6. CHAIRMAN OF THE PARLIAMENT’S HEALTHCARE COMMITTEE: UNLIKE LAST YEAR, THERE IS NO MORE OVEREXPENDITURE IN UNIVERSAL HEALTHCARE PROGRAM
Economics

Chairman of the Parliament’s Committee for Healthcare and Social Issues Akaki Zoidze stated: “The tendency is kept in absence of overexpenditure in universal healthcare program, unlike last year”. “Effective steps of the Ministry [of Labor, Healthcare and Social Protection] caused establishment of fiscal order”, he said.

7. TOURISM ADMINISTRATION CONTINUES COOPERATION WITH “GOOGLE”
Economics

Georgian National Tourism Administration reported that meeting was held with representatives of Google Corporation, at which ongoing cooperation and future plans were discussed. The administration cooperates with Google for 2 years already.

8. IN Q2, PORTFOLIO INVESTMENTS MADE UP $30M
Economics

National Bank of Georgia reported that portfolio investments in Georgia amounted in the 2nd quarter to $30 million. In regard of GDP, this indicator makes up 0.8%.

9. AS OF SEPTEMBER, PRICE PER SHARE OF “BOG HOLDINGS” MADE UP 33.2 GBP, OF “TBC BANK GROUP” – 16.3 GBP
Business

Referring to Bloomberg, National Bank of Georgia reported that as of September, price per share of BOG Holdings at the London Stock Exchange made up 33.2 GBP, while of TBC Bank Group – 16.3 GBP.

To compare, these prices in January made up respective 28.5 GBP and 14.6 GBP.

10. REGULATING COMMISSION GAVE PRELIMINARY CONSENT TO ACQUISITION OF OPERATIONAL ASSET OF “GLOBAL CONTACT CONSULTING” BY “SILKNET”
Business

National Communication Commission reported that JSC SilkNet plans acquisition of operational asset of JSC Global Contact Consulting, informing on this intent the Commission.

The operational asset consists of 2 licenses for radio-frequency range use, coaxial cables, antennas and their parts, the Commission specified.
